X chromosome inactivation (XCI) in feminine embryos, which takes place early in zygote advancement, can also be mediated by DNA methylation. In girls, just one X chromosome is randomly chosen for chromosome-broad transcriptional silencing, which equalises the expression of X-linked genes involving genders.38 During enhancement and ageing, varying levels of escape from XCI by means of demethylation can manifest in cells in a tissue leading to phenotypic discrepancies.39 the feminine bias noticed in SLE continues to be connected to genes that escape XCI. The X chromosome has the greatest density of immunity-related genes outside of the major histocompatibility intricate (MHC) location, and overexpression of such genes is often a critical Think about the breakdown of self-tolerance.

there are numerous sites of MTHFR polymorphism that were reported including two enzyme exercise affiliated locuses C677T and A1298C and six enzyme activity unassociated locuses6. As demonstrated in desk one, regarding the Affiliation of MTHFR gene and its enzyme merchandise, a lot of the scientific tests revealed significant enzymatic deficiency. The encoding of MTHFR appears for being polymorphic including the gene website C677T, Probably the most examined and clinically critical variant in exon 4. The C677T variant outcomes from just one nucleotide substitution at this position, during which cytosine is replaced by thymine resulting a conversion of alanine to valine residue24.

One more important part of MTFHR is always to engage in donating methyl team to manage epigenetic modification from the 1-carbon metabolism. Methylation is a typical regulation means of gene expression that influences cellular improvement and function22, and that is dependent on SAM for a methyl donor. SAM originated from methionine cycle wherein five-methyl THF transfers methyl groups to homocysteine inside a response catalyzed by methionine synthase to produce methionine.

Comparing to Schizophrenia and melancholy, relatively constrained reports of MTHFR in autism are actually executed. Some reports confirmed increased frequency of C677T polymorphism in children with ASD than in balanced controls80, or connected with ASD behavior phenotypes81. A possibility analyze of ASD with regular growth indicated important conversation outcomes amongst maternal TT genotype and increased threat for ASD82, suggesting MTHFR polymorphism may include the early advancement of ASD.
